This amazing ribs recipe uses a three-step cooking method to make these incredible, tender ribs. They're boiled, grilled, then simmered in a slow cooker.

Recipe Instructions
Step 1
Meanwhile, preheat an outdoor grill for high heat and lightly oil the grate.
Step 2
Cut ribs into 2- or 3-bone portions. Bring a large pot of water to a boil; season with pinch each salt, black pepper, and red pepper flakes. Add ribs; boil for 20 minutes. Drain; let sit about 30 minutes
Step 3
Lightly coat ribs with barbecue sauce. Cook on the preheated grill until achieve a nice grilled look, 5 to 10 minutes per side. Transfer ribs to a slow cooker.
Step 4
Pour remaining barbecue sauce and 1 bottle beer over ribs; this should cover at least half the ribs. Cover slow cooker. Cook on High until meat is falling off the bone, about 3 hours, checking every hour or so; add more beer if needed to dilute sauce, stirring to ensure ribs are on top in sauce.
Ingredients
1 pinch salt
1 pinch crushed red pepper
1 pinch black pepper
6 pounds pork baby back ribs
4 cups barbecue sauce
2 (12 ounce) bottles porter beer, room temperature
